(4.58-ft x 3-ft x 1.42-ft) x (1,728 cubic inches per cubic foot) / (231 cubic inches per gallon) = 145.95 gallons.

Note:

That's the capacity (volume) of the hole in the ground described.

We have no way to know how much water is in it at the moment.
